Transaction 8071643d695a0010766bb86a8db87833f2307b4b06ae27eabd7244b3106b1f03

8 Input
2 Outputs
  • 8071643d695a0010766bb86a8db87833f2307b4b06ae27eabd7244b3106b1f03:0
  • value  84205
    address  bc1q524xehp3vcwsymhhngt38sc2l4cwpz28ln4ycrz6578u7x6q6dlqfea4wp
  • 8071643d695a0010766bb86a8db87833f2307b4b06ae27eabd7244b3106b1f03:1
  • value  29625000
    address  38vwf8TWRL9uc7GSp55GhhmSZZD4cWRKz5